Balochistan Traders Demand Probe Into Lakpass Warehouse Fire

Business and transport sector representatives in Balochistan on Thursday called for a comprehensive high-level inquiry into the large-scale fire that destroyed the Lakpass Customs post warehouse near Quetta earlier this week, alleging that the incident may have been intentionally orchestrated to conceal theft and irregularities involving confiscated goods.

During a joint press briefing held in Quetta, trade leaders asserted that the commercial community incurred losses estimated at approximately ₨9 billion as a result of the blaze, which engulfed the customs warehouse located in the Luk Pass area of Mastung District on Sunday and reportedly left at least 43 individuals injured.

Abdul Rahim Kakar, President of the Central Anjuman-i-Tajran, stated that the fire “could not be accidental” and alleged that the incident formed part of a broader conspiracy aimed at concealing the theft of seized merchandise stored at the facility. He further demanded registration of a formal FIR against those responsible and called for immediate financial compensation for affected traders and business owners.

Additional business representatives, including Mir Nawab Mengal and Haji Malik Shah Jamaldini, also raised concerns regarding the circumstances surrounding the incident. They alleged that certain valuable consignments may have been removed from the warehouse prior to the outbreak of the fire.

Authorities have not yet issued an official response to the allegations raised by the business community.

Earlier statements from rescue officials indicated that the intensity of the fire increased significantly due to the presence of LPG cylinders, fuel reserves, and other hazardous chemical materials stored within the warehouse premises.
